Population Non-Hispanic American Indian % by Zip Code (ZCTA5) — Nevada

NOTE: Gray indicates insufficient data or a suppressed estimate.

Zip codes in the northwestern part of Nevada, particularly in the Pyramid Lake and Duck Valley reservation areas, display the highest Non-Hispanic American Indian population percentages, reaching 50% or above, with a few ZCTAs approaching near-total concentration. The Las Vegas metropolitan area in the southern tip and the Reno-Sparks urban core generally exhibit very low percentages (under 1-3%), consistent with their large, demographically diverse populations diluting any single group's share. A notable contrast exists between the rural northern and central zip codes—many of which reflect reservation lands or small tribal communities with elevated percentages—and the vast, sparsely populated interior ZCTAs shown in gray, which likely lack sufficient population for reporting.
